N.J.S.A. 43:6-6.34

Securing coverage following approval by referendum

43:6-6.34. Securing coverage following approval by referendum The State Treasurer is further directed to secure social security coverage for such members of the Supreme Court and judges of the Superior Court within 60 days after a majority of such judges qualified to vote in a referendum as required by section 218(d)(3) of the Social Security Act shall have voted to be covered under terms of that act. L.1967, c. 47, s. 2, eff. May 15, 1967.
